X-Git-Url: http://git.megacz.com/?a=blobdiff_plain;f=tests%2Fmeta.g;h=b1fb352417b934725976b9d64399d4255b61a0c8;hb=2244708b6521e2ee6ac89e24887119abda93da3a;hp=7dff3eb8801cc44f963383d2d3a7199d085f1ce2;hpb=028c0419378758379cef3b058f5b0cb9ff9639fc;p=sbp.git diff --git a/tests/meta.g b/tests/meta.g index 7dff3eb..b1fb352 100644 --- a/tests/meta.g +++ b/tests/meta.g @@ -36,10 +36,14 @@ e ::= word => "nonTerminal" | ^"{" Sequence "}" /ws | ^"[" Range* "]" - | (e ^"++" /ws > e ^"+" /ws) - | (e ^"++/" e /ws > e ^"+/" e /ws) - | (e ^"**" /ws > e ^"*" /ws) - | (e ^"**/" e /ws > e ^"*/" e /ws) + | e ^"++" /ws -> ~[/] + | e ^"+" /ws -> ~[+] + | e ^"++/" e /ws + | e ^"+/" e /ws + | e ^"**" /ws -> ~[/] + | e ^"*" /ws -> ~[*] + | e ^"**/" e /ws + | e ^"*/" e /ws | ^"!" e /ws | e ^"?" /ws